We were delighted to hear from Hayley who recently rehomed six-year-old mare Come On Linda.

Come On Linda was named by our late and dear friend, owner Linda Folwell. When we tried to sell her a horse we'd always say "Oh come on Linda". And then one day, when her horse was ready for naming Linda said to us "That's the name, I'll call her 'Come On Linda'."

Linda Folwell enjoyed much success as a racehorse owner, with Arrowtown, Black Grass and Magic City amongst her many winners.

Linda sadly died in 2021 after a short illness but her name is kept alive by her pride and joy, Come On Linda.

Come On Linda was one of Linda's favourite horses. She was placed eight times from 19 starts, and was unlucky not to win having been beaten just a short head at Chelmsford in 2021. After racing Come On Linda became a broodmare before retiring from the paddocks and being rehomed.



Come On Linda has settled well and is loving life after racing


"Come On Linda has settled in well down in Leicestershire," says Hayley. "We've been hacking out alone and in company and she enjoys being out in the field with the sheep! She's brill".
